The Roman Mass: From Early Christian Origins to Tridentine Reform Lang, Uwe Michael (St Mary's University, Twickenham, London)
The Roman Mass: From Early Christian Origins to Tridentine Reform
Lang, Uwe Michael (St Mary's University, Twickenham, London)
A compact guide to the basic structure and ritual shape of the Roman Mass from its formative period in late antiquity to the Tridentine reform. Uniting classical liturgical history with insights from a variety of other disciplines, the book offers the picture of a liturgy celebrated and lived.
